#6242ec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6242ec is composed of 38.4% red, 25.9% green and 92.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.5% cyan, 72%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 251.3 degrees, a saturation of 81.7% and a lightness of 59.2%. #6242ec color hex could be obtained by blending #c484ff with #0000d9. Closest websafe color is: #6633ff.

Shades and Tints of #6242ec
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020107 is the darkest color, while #f6f4f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#6242ec
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#94929c is the less saturated color, while #5832fc is the most saturated one.
